High-Pressure Laminate (HPL) has found extensive applications across a wide range of industries due to its versatility and durability. In the furniture market, HPL is commonly used for tabletops, cabinets, and shelves, as it offers a sleek and stylish finish that is resistant to scratches, heat, and moisture. The high-pressure manufacturing process ensures that the HPL surfaces are sturdy and long-lasting, making them ideal for high-traffic areas in commercial and residential spaces.
Moreover, the healthcare sector utilizes HPL for the production of cabinets, work surfaces, and wall claddings due to its hygienic properties and ease of maintenance. HPL surfaces are non-porous, making them resistant to bacteria and easy to clean, thus meeting the stringent hygiene requirements of healthcare facilities. Additionally, the chemical and impact resistance of HPL make it a preferred choice in laboratories and cleanroom environments where a sterile and durable surface is essential for daily operations.

High-Pressure Laminate (HPL) is known for its superior durability and resistance to wear and tear compared to other laminate materials. The production process involves layering multiple sheets of kraft paper saturated with resin and decorative paper on top, which are compressed and heated to create a strong and resilient final product. This unique manufacturing method results in HPL being highly scratch, impact, and moisture resistant, making it an ideal choice for high-traffic areas where durability is paramount.
In contrast, Low-Pressure Laminate (LPL) and Direct Pressure Laminate (DPL) are often considered more cost-effective alternatives to HPL. LPL is typically used for vertical applications such as cabinetry and furniture surfaces, while DPL is commonly used for flooring. However, both LPL and DPL lack the same level of durability and resilience that HPL offers, making them more susceptible to damage over time. Additionally, HPL comes in a wider range of colors, patterns, and finishes, allowing for greater design versatility compared to other laminate materials.
